    This is generally OK, but you should be careful not to have more than one output active at any given time on a single net. If there are two or more outputs connected together driving opposite states, large currents will result. For this reason, it is best if the I/Os of the secondary expander are all configured as inputs until it is needed (e.g., in the event of the primary expander failing somehow).
